How to set up the Opera Mail client
This article demonstrates how to set up Opera Mail to access an XauZit Cloud e-mail account and send messages.
To configure Opera Mail to work with your XauZit Cloud e-mail account, follow these steps:
- Make sure you have already created at least one e-mail account for your domain. If you have not done this, please see this article to learn how to create an e-mail account using cPanel.
- Start Opera Mail.
- If you are running Opera Mail for the first time, the New Account Wizard dialog box appears automatically. Otherwise, click Opera Mail in the top-left corner of the application window, click Mail Accounts, and then click Add to start the New Account Wizard.
- Select Email, and then click Next:

- In the Real name text box, type the name that you want to appear on messages you send:

- In the Email address text box, type the e-mail address of the account you created in cPanel, and then click Next.
- In the Login name text box, type the e-mail address of the account you created in cPanel:

- In the Password text box, type the password for the e-mail account you created in cPanel.
- Select the type of incoming mail server that you want to use:
- If you want to use POP, select Regular email (POP).
- If you want to use IMAP, select IMAP.
- Click Next.
- In the Incoming server text box, type the XauZit Cloud server name for your account, followed by one of the following:
- If you want to use POP, add :995 to the server name.
- If you want to use IMAP, add :993 to the server name.
For example, if your XauZit Cloud server name is server.cloud.xauzit.com and you want to use IMAP, type server.cloud.xauzit.com:993.

- Select the Use secure connection (TLS) check box.
- In the Outgoing server text box, type the XauZit Cloud server name for your account, followed by :465. For example, if your XauZit Cloud server name is server.cloud.xauzit.com, type s87.cloud.xauzit.com:465.
- Select the Use secure connection (TLS) check box.
- Click Finish. Opera Mail displays the inbox and downloads any messages in the account:
